Lost Coast & Mattole Road - Cape Mendocino

California's wildest wilderness coast where Highway 1 couldn't be built. Rugged, patched asphalt and gravel washouts threading past Cape Mendocino's wild Pacific surf, sheep ranches, and remote redwoods.

How many curves and miles is Lost Coast & Mattole Road - Cape Mendocino?

Lost Coast & Mattole Road - Cape Mendocino spans 65 miles and packs approximately 340 curves (5.2 curves per mile) with an elevation delta of 20 ft - 2,300 ft and technical rating 8/10.

Where are the start and end coordinates?

The route starts at Ferndale, CA (Latitude 40.5762, Longitude -124.2639) and finishes at Humboldt Redwoods / Weott, CA (Latitude 40.3207, Longitude -123.9214).
